Here are plenty more facts about this year’s LolliBop:
- LolliBop is the UK’s biggest kids festival, where all activity is aimed at the under 10s.
- The three-day event takes place from August 16 – 18 at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park, London.
- The line-up includes Cbeebies superstar Justin Fletcher (Saturday and Sunday only), Dick and Dom, Skylanders SWAP Force, Shaun The Sheep Championsheeps, Peppa Pig, Science Museum Live, Postman Pat, The Diary of a Wimpy Kid, Transformers, Poppy Cat, Rastamouse (Friday only) and Cloudbabies.
LolliBop’s live theatre tent – The Lollipalladiam – showcases performances from pioneering and internationally renowned companies and artists.
Tween Town is especially for older kids, with cool activities like DJ workshops, movie editing and beatboxing masterclasses.
Lolli Stops are situated throughout the festival for 3-10 year olds to get crafty, there’s also a 3ft and under zone for pre-schoolers.
The Enchanted Forest will host reading and stories, and there’s also a brand new Discovery Zone, Meadows area, Lolli Promenade and much more.
